Garth On 1 February 2013 11:46, Johan Hake <[email protected]> wrote: > Hello! > > Recently there have been some annoyance with distutils and how we > runtime check where swig is. Kent, Johannes and I have now added a CMake > based system. Both UFC and DOLFIN use that now to JIT compile extension > modules. It uses what ever compiler defined in the UseFOO file. The > default configuration system of instant is still distutils, retaining > all backward compatibility. > > The configuability of instant using cmake is reduced compared to > distutils, as it just reads in UseFOO files.
